git分支人员管理
-
Git分支人员管理是指在团队协作开发过程中,如何有效地管理和跟踪不同成员在不同分支上的工作。以下是一些常见的Git分支人员管理的方法:
1. 分支权限管理:在团队中,可以根据成员的角色和权限设置分支的访问权限。通常,只有负责某个功能或模块的成员才能对该分支进行修改和提交。可以通过Git仓库的权限设置、分支保护规则或者代码审查工具进行权限管理。
2. 分支命名规范:为了方便识别和管理,可以制定分支命名规范。例如,可以使用feature/、bugfix/等前缀来表示不同类型的分支,后面跟上功能或Bug的简要描述。这样,团队成员就能够快速了解每个分支的用途和状态。
3. 分支合并策略:在合作开发中,不同成员可能会在同一时间在不同的分支上进行开发。为了保证代码的稳定性和一致性,需要制定分支合并策略。常用的策略有:主干式(在主分支上进行开发,其他分支通过合并主分支更新)和功能分支式(每个新功能或修复都开辟一个独立的分支,并进行合并)等。
4. 分支管理工具:为了更好地管理分支和跟踪分支的工作进度,可以使用一些分支管理工具。例如,GitLab、GitHub等代码托管服务提供了便捷的分支管理功能,可以创建、合并和删除分支,查看分支的提交记录和状态等。
5. 建立良好的沟通和协作机制:在团队中,及时的沟通和协作是保证分支人员管理顺利进行的关键。成员之间需要及时共享分支的状态、工作进度和相关问题,以避免代码冲突和重复工作。可以通过团队会议、即时通讯工具或项目管理工具来进行沟通和协作。
总之,Git分支人员管理是团队协作开发中不可或缺的一环。通过合理的权限管理、命名规范、合并策略和工具支持,可以有效地管理和跟踪团队成员在不同分支上的工作,提高开发效率和代码质量。此外,良好的沟通和协作机制也是顺利进行分支管理的重要因素。
2年前 -
在Git中,分支是一种非常重要的功能,它允许开发人员在同一个代码库中并行开发多个功能或修复不同的问题。对于团队管理来说,有效地管理Git分支可以提高合作效率和代码质量。
下面是五个关键点,用于管理Git分支中的团队成员:
1. 定义分支策略:在开始使用Git分支之前,团队应该先制定一个分支策略。这个策略应该明确定义哪些分支用于开发新功能、修复bug、发布版本等不同的目的。团队应该遵循这个分支策略,并确保所有成员都清楚地了解每个分支的目的和使用方式。
2. 分配任务与分支:团队成员在开始开发新功能或修复bug之前,应该首先分配任务并创建相应的分支。每个任务应该与一个特定的分支相关联,这样就可以保持任务的隔离性,避免不同任务之间的代码冲突。团队应该有一个共享的任务跟踪系统,用于分配任务和记录每个任务的分支。
3. 分支合并与冲突解决:当一个任务完成并通过测试时,团队成员应该将其分支合并回主分支(如develop分支)。在合并之前,应该先更新主分支以包含最新的更改。如果多个团队成员同时修改了同一个文件的相同部分,就可能发生代码冲突。在合并时,需要解决这些冲突。团队成员应该熟悉常见的冲突解决技巧,并在合并之前进行代码审查和测试。
4. 分支命名与说明:为了方便团队管理和沟通,分支应该明确命名并附带说明。命名应该能够清楚地表达分支的目的和作用,例如feature/xxx用于开发新功能,bugfix/xxx用于修复bug,release/xxx用于发布版本等。说明应该包含分支的相关信息和时间表,方便团队成员理解和查找。
5. 定期清理和维护:随着时间的推移,Git分支库可能会变得庞大且混乱。为了维持良好的团队管理,团队应该定期清理和维护分支。删除已经合并的分支,并确保保留重要的、尚未合并的分支。同时,注意关注长时间没有合并的分支,应该与相关成员进行沟通,确认是否有进展或需要关闭。维护一个清洁有序的分支库对于提高团队效率和代码质量非常重要。
总结起来,团队成员管理Git分支应该包括:定义分支策略、分配任务与分支、分支合并和冲突解决、分支命名与说明、定期清理和维护。这些管理方法可以帮助团队提高合作效率、保持代码质量和减少冲突。
2年前 -
Git是一款非常强大的版本控制系统,可以帮助团队协作开发时管理不同的分支。在Git中,分支可用于同时进行多个不同功能的开发或修复工作,使得开发人员可以并行进行工作,而不会互相干扰。
在Git中,分支的管理包括创建、切换、合并和删除等操作。下面将从分支的创建、切换、合并和删除等方面介绍Git分支的人员管理。
1. 创建一个新分支:
要在Git中创建一个新的分支,可以使用`git branch`命令,将当前分支复制为一个新的分支。语法如下:
“`
git branch
“`
这将在仓库中创建一个名为``的新分支。 2. 切换到一个分支:
在Git中,要切换到已存在的分支,可以使用`git checkout`命令。语法如下:
“`
git checkout
“`
这将使得当前工作目录和索引切换到指定的``分支。 3. 合并分支:
当一个分支的开发或修复工作完成后,可以将其合并到其他分支中。通常,我们使用`git merge`命令将一个分支的更改集成到当前分支。 使用如下命令:
“`
git checkout
git merge“`
在上面的命令中,``是你要将更改合并到的目标分支,` `是你要合并的源分支。合并将把源分支的更改应用到目标分支上。 4. 删除分支:
完成对某个分支的开发或修复工作后,我们可以删除该分支以清理仓库。要删除分支,可以使用`git branch -d`命令。语法如下:
“`
git branch -d
“`
这将从仓库中删除指定的``分支。 以上是Git分支的基本操作,这些操作可以帮助团队协作开发中的分支人员管理。团队成员可以根据自己的需求创建自己的分支,在自己的分支上进行开发/修复工作,并在完成工作后将更改合并到主分支或其他合适的分支中。通过这样的方式,可以实现并行开发,提高团队的工作效率。
2年前